WebThe value of a put option at expiration is; The value an option would have if it expired today is its intrinsic value. The time value of an option is the difference between its current value and its intrinsic value. If the intrinsic value of an option is positive, the option is in-the-money. WebSep 14, 2024 · To calculate the intrinsic value of an option, we take the current price and subtract the strike (for calls). In this example, the 140 call option has an intrinsic value of ($149.02 – $140) = $9.02. That is the intrinsic value of an option if exercised today.
